From 7169562133632e11fb4f564211a1db1aa61bab5c Mon Sep 17 00:00:00 2001 From: "Jasper St. Pierre" Date: Thu, 31 Jan 2013 23:40:20 -0500 Subject: doctool: Initial import of a Gjs language that we support Copy/pasted from Python. --- giscanner/doctemplates/Gjs/enum.tmpl | 11 +++++++++++ 1 file changed, 11 insertions(+) create mode 100644 giscanner/doctemplates/Gjs/enum.tmpl (limited to 'giscanner/doctemplates/Gjs/enum.tmpl') diff --git a/giscanner/doctemplates/Gjs/enum.tmpl b/giscanner/doctemplates/Gjs/enum.tmpl new file mode 100644 index 00000000..840f79f5 --- /dev/null +++ b/giscanner/doctemplates/Gjs/enum.tmpl @@ -0,0 +1,11 @@ +<%inherit file="/base.tmpl"/> +<%block name="details"> +% if node.members: +
+% for member, ix in zip(node.members, range(len(node.members))): +

${node.name}.${member.name.upper()} :

+
${formatter.format(node, member.doc)}
+% endfor +
+% endif + -- cgit v1.2.1 From ff80c6d88a28b26576508ab891c9b9da0b13ac49 Mon Sep 17 00:00:00 2001 From: "Jasper St. Pierre" Date: Sat, 2 Feb 2013 11:07:42 -0500 Subject: doctool: Don't use zip(range(L)) Instead, remove it entirely (since we don't need the index) or instead use enumerate(). --- giscanner/doctemplates/Gjs/enum.tmpl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'giscanner/doctemplates/Gjs/enum.tmpl') diff --git a/giscanner/doctemplates/Gjs/enum.tmpl b/giscanner/doctemplates/Gjs/enum.tmpl index 840f79f5..2624c425 100644 --- a/giscanner/doctemplates/Gjs/enum.tmpl +++ b/giscanner/doctemplates/Gjs/enum.tmpl @@ -2,7 +2,7 @@ <%block name="details"> % if node.members:
-% for member, ix in zip(node.members, range(len(node.members))): +% for member in node.members:

${node.name}.${member.name.upper()} :

${formatter.format(node, member.doc)}
% endfor -- cgit v1.2.1 From 3b64a2e808ae25b437c30bec237ada89dc4bcfb3 Mon Sep 17 00:00:00 2001 From: "Jasper St. Pierre" Date: Thu, 14 Feb 2013 22:47:10 -0500 Subject: doctool: Fix use of
tag in templates This isn't legal Mallard --- giscanner/doctemplates/Gjs/enum.tmpl |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) (limited to 'giscanner/doctemplates/Gjs/enum.tmpl') diff --git a/giscanner/doctemplates/Gjs/enum.tmpl b/giscanner/doctemplates/Gjs/enum.tmpl index 2624c425..35cdd439 100644 --- a/giscanner/doctemplates/Gjs/enum.tmpl +++ b/giscanner/doctemplates/Gjs/enum.tmpl @@ -1,11 +1,13 @@ <%inherit file="/base.tmpl"/> <%block name="details"> % if node.members: -
+ % for member in node.members: -

${node.name}.${member.name.upper()} :

-
${formatter.format(node, member.doc)}
+ +<code>${node.name}.${member.name.upper()}</code> +${formatter.format(node, member.doc)} + % endfor -
+ % endif -- cgit v1.2.1